Ok some rough measurements taken and sorry guys but it looks like a non starter,
Rear door window:
TOP: 54cm
MIDDLE: 66CM
BOTTOM:66CM
REAR QUATER WINDOW:
TOP; 54CM
MIDDLE:55CM
BOTTOM:58 CM
REAR SCREEN:
TOP: 109CM
MIDDLE: 120CM
BOTTOM: 131CM

Again these are only rough quides but if anyone has a B5 in my area i am willing to try them in one.
